Register FAQ Search Today's Posts Mark Forums Read
Go Back   JazzJackrabbit Community Forums » Maintenance & Feedback » JJ2+ Issue Tracker

Feature Request Bots and Players Count

Necrolyte

JCF Member

Joined: Jan 1970

Posts: 13

Necrolyte has disabled reputation

Feb 10, 2022, 08:08 AM
Necrolyte is offline
Reply With Quote
Lightbulb Bots and Players Count

Can we have a packet that is sent by bots to inform the server that the client is a bot and not a regular JJ2 client?

One use of this is to exclude bots from player count in server list to know actual players count in a server.

You see servers with player count of 4/32, 2/32, etc all the time while they are actually empty of players.
Necrolyte

JCF Member

Joined: Jan 1970

Posts: 13

Necrolyte has disabled reputation

Feb 10, 2022, 08:24 AM
Necrolyte is offline
Reply With Quote
image

https://i.imgur.com/01rs1gN.png
Stijn

Administrator

Joined: Mar 2001

Posts: 6,965

Stijn is a splendid one to beholdStijn is a splendid one to beholdStijn is a splendid one to beholdStijn is a splendid one to beholdStijn is a splendid one to beholdStijn is a splendid one to beholdStijn is a splendid one to behold

Feb 10, 2022, 04:01 PM
Stijn is offline
Reply With Quote
This is a good idea, though it will not be trivial to implement (but also not impossible)
ShakerNL

JCF Member

Joined: May 2009

Posts: 115

ShakerNL is an asset to this forumShakerNL is an asset to this forum

Feb 17, 2022, 04:43 AM
ShakerNL is offline
Reply With Quote
There is an option in the sgip config to hide certain player names from the list. I was experimenting with it a week ago, but decided to revert it back.
__________________
Violet CLM

JCF Éminence Grise

Joined: Mar 2001

Posts: 11,047

Violet CLM has disabled reputation

Mar 2, 2023, 02:56 PM
Violet CLM is offline
Reply With Quote
Filtering by player name is probably a safe alternative. If servers ignored players whose names start with "Bot," and ignored spectators, those two changes should give us accurate player counts.
__________________
Necrolyte

JCF Member

Joined: Jan 1970

Posts: 13

Necrolyte has disabled reputation

Mar 5, 2023, 01:44 AM
Necrolyte is offline
Reply With Quote
Quote:
Originally Posted by Violet CLM View Post
Filtering by player name is probably a safe alternative. If servers ignored players whose names start with "Bot," and ignored spectators, those two changes should give us accurate player counts.
This would do the job too if server owners collaborated, even though what I suggested is more convenient and more accurate IMO as it would only require us bot creators (Cranky and me) to modify our bots and remove setup complications for server owners.

About ignoring spectators, I'm personally not for that. If there's some ODT tornament with 20 participants, server will show 2/14 insead of 20/32 on the menu?

Actually your idea to ignore spectators gave me an idea, why don't we have 2 swappable player counts on the menu? For example let's say we have a server with 20 players, and only 2 players are playing, while the other 18 are spectating the match, we can have the server list menu showing [20/32] ny default, and if you hold down tab key, the player count of that server will show as [2/14], and if you release the tab key, it will go back to [20/32]. Maybe we can accomplish this by adding both player counts somewhere to the query response packet (0x06), like putting it before the data Stijn added on v5.5.

These are just my personal opinons, the name alternative would do the job even though there are better approaches.
Reply

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ump

All times are GMT -8. The time now is 11:41 PM.